avatarCaringEthos2 years ago

In Fallout Shelter, a female Dweller stays pregnant for about 3 real-time hours. But don't worry, you won't have to deliver the baby yourself! After those hours, you'll have a new little vault-dweller ready to grow up and start contributing to your vault's success. Make sure you've got enough room and resources!
